90k notes post completely misrepresenting why screenshotting or re-streaming Netflix doesn't work. It's not just the hardware acceleration, it's DRM. if you take this post at face value it would follow that you're unable to screenshot pretty much any video game bc your GPU is involved which is obviously fucking wrong.
in the case of Netflix & co without hardware acceleration the CPU has the job of decrypting the DRM'ed video stream which makes it a) screenshotable and b) will significantly reduce quality since decrypting 1080p upwards with a CPU is too resource-intensive. With hardware acceleration (and assuming that every piece of hardware in the chain supports HDCP) the stream will remain encrypted and is passed to the display this way and therefore your OS can't take a screenshot of the content. But once again this is only the case if there's even any DRM used. For example YouTube doesn't use HDCP (so you can take screenshots with hardware acceleration enabled) so the only thing you'd achieve when you disable hardware acceleration in this case is kneecapping your PC's performance. you're just making everything more inefficient, good job!
I mean, if your goal is capturing shit from Netflix then turning off hardware acceleration does work so regarding that the post is correct, but the explanation is shit and the implications of doing that are not explained at all (which is always fun if you offer solutions with unintended consequences to a non-tech-savvy audience).

For those wondering how to add the filter to their posts or reblogs: turn on beta post editor on desktop and it'll show the option. Mobile will probably get it later.
Interesting with the mature content, you don't have to tag every reblog with the filter. It seems if the original poster does it it automatically filters for you.
